Sec. 1.

As soon as practicable after the effective date of this Act but in no event later than July 31, 1955, the Adjutant General shall transfer all books, records and documents in his custody relating to the payment of compensation to veterans of World War I and their beneficiaries to the Archives Division of the State Library for permanent filing. Such books, records and documents shall be confidential and shall be shown only upon the authorization of the Adjutant General or the Governor of the State of Illinois. Prior to such transfer, the Adjutant General shall make a final inventory of the books, records and documents. The Adjutant General may cause any book, record, or document to be microphotographed, photographed, microfilmed, or otherwise reproduced on film and may destroy the original of any such records that have been so reproduced.

(Source: Laws 1955, p. 1069.)

Sec. 1.1. Short title

This Act may be cited as the Service Compensation Records Transfer Act.

(Source: P.A. 86-1324.)
